A kind of fusible plug for fluid-flywheel clutch
Technical field
The utility model is related to engine fluid-flywheel clutch technical field, more particularly to a kind of for fluid-flywheel clutch Fusible plug.
Background technology
Fusible plug is that i.e. fusing, opening channel make fluid at a higher temperature using the low melting point fusible metal in device Pressure of releasing is ejected from the hole for the fusible metal filled originally.
It is a kind of fusible metal (fusible metal alloy) of filling in existing fusible plug, if the axis of fusible metal filling Too short to length, then compressive effect is poor, is easy to deviate from the cock body of fusible plug under high pressure, if the axial direction of fusible metal filling Length is long, then the melting time of fusible metal substantially extend, superheat protecting function cannot be effectively acted as in due course.
And existing fusible plug is typically disposable, and be monolithic construction, waste of material is serious.

Specific implementation mode
Referring to Fig. 1, a kind of fusible plug for fluid-flywheel clutch, including cock body, the cock body include outer barrel, inner body, institute The peripheral surface setting connection screw thread of outer barrel is stated, institute's outer barrel includes cross section in the head of regular hexagon and takes shape in head one end Screw rod interconnecting piece, the connection screw thread is arranged on the peripheral surface of screw rod interconnecting piece, and the path on the head connects more than screw rod The outer diameter of socket part.The head end face adjacent with screw rod interconnecting piece forms annular groove, and the first sealing ring is arranged in annular groove, First sealing ring protrudes outside annular groove.One end end that first sealing ring protrudes outside annular groove is arc-shaped.The outer barrel Endoporus in step type, the path section of the outer barrel endoporus is located at the major diameter section outside of outer barrel endoporus.
The peripheral surface of the inner body is in step type, and the path section screw-thread fit of the inner body is in the path section of outer barrel endoporus Interior, the major diameter section of the inner body is located in the major diameter section of outer barrel endoporus, the major diameter section of the inner body and the major diameter section of outer barrel endoporus Hole wall between there are bit space is allowed, the axis part of the inner body is equipped with axially extending bore in an axial direction, is set in the axially extending bore There is clamping screw thread, the fusible metal poured is made to be difficult to.It is arranged for turning inner body on the end face of the inner body major diameter section Card slot loads and unloads inner body for coordinating with sheets tools such as screwdrivers.The second sealing ring, institute are cased in the path section of the inner body It states the second sealing ring to be located between the major diameter section of the inner body, the path section of the outer barrel endoporus, between sealed outer cylinder, inner body Gap, and do not contacted with fusible metal.
The axially extending bore is three-level stepped hole, and the interstitial hole of the three-level stepped hole is less than the aperture of both ends of the hole, wherein It is respectively arranged with higher melting-point fusible metal column in the both ends of the hole, lower melting-point meltable gold is provided in the interstitial hole Belong to column, the fusing point of the higher melting-point fusible metal column is the overheating protection fusing point of fusible plug.It is described higher melting-point meltable 10-30 DEG C of the fusing point difference of metal column, lower melting-point fusible metal column.The fusing point of the higher melting-point fusible metal column is 120-140℃。
The connection method of inner body, fusible metal column:
1. the first fusible metal column of cast three-level stepped hole inner end pours into a mould the fusible metal column in interstitial hole after cooling, cold But the successively gradual fusible metal column for pouring into a mould outer end after.
2. the first fusible metal column of cast three-level stepped hole inner end pours into a mould the fusible metal column in interstitial hole, so after cooling Rear thread coordinates the fusible metal column of outer end, but sealing effect is slightly worse than method 1.
3. by three fusible metal column whole screw threads in corresponding hole, then heat meltable plug, heating temperature are fusing point Higher fusible metal column, lower melting-point fusible metal column fusing point between, force out the air in three-level stepped hole, make air It is run out of from thread gaps, and the fusible metal column in interstitial hole is made to melt, form sealing function, in heating process, by fusible plug It is vertical to place.This method is relatively simple, and manufacturing speed is fast, but sealing effect is slightly worse than method 1,2.
